如何在Visual Studio 2017中构建VSTS扩展。在package.json中配置的post build事件在Visual Studio中不起作用。
只有命令npm run build会触发build和postbuild事件。我希望在构建VisualStudio 2017项目时创建vsix文件。
答案 0 :(得分:1)
我们无法直接构建以在VS中生成vsix文件。正如您所说,我们只能触发postbuild事件来调用命令tfx extension create --manifest-globs vss-extension.json
来打包它。
要创建TFS / VSTS扩展,您可以参考本文的详细信息:Create your first extension with Visual Studio
要打包为vsix文件,请参阅Packaging and publishing - Package
如果您的意思是创建Visual Studio VSIX包,那么您可以参考以下文章: